Output 861134d847c8e387b60e7cd1806cf65d6a27a44b22b24a54af7074ee1e5b6454:4

value
124393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d2f82ab7e4e558b819e7dd46d89d0a7ca0652cf OP_EQUAL
address
3D6wJc3f51UNKi7pE2SmnMcxM5LtBFwHX3
transaction
861134d847c8e387b60e7cd1806cf65d6a27a44b22b24a54af7074ee1e5b6454
confirmations
310995
spent
true